✨ What is Vector Subtraction?

Vector subtraction is the process of finding the difference between two vectors. If you have two vectors: A=(Ax,Ay)andB=(Bx,By)\mathbf{A} = (A_x, A_y) \quad \text{and} \quad \mathbf{B} = (B_x, B_y)A=(Ax​,Ay​)andB=(Bx​,By​)

The subtraction is: A−B=(Ax−Bx,  Ay−By)\mathbf{A} – \mathbf{B} = (A_x – B_x, \; A_y – B_y)A−B=(Ax​−Bx​,Ay​−By​)

In 3D: A−B=(Ax−Bx,  Ay−By,  Az−Bz)\mathbf{A} – \mathbf{B} = (A_x – B_x, \; A_y – B_y, \; A_z – B_z)A−B=(Ax​−Bx​,Ay​−By​,Az​−Bz​)

This gives you the resultant vector pointing from B to A.

📊 Example of Vector Subtraction

Suppose: A=(6,  4)andB=(2,  1)\mathbf{A} = (6, \; 4) \quad \text{and} \quad \mathbf{B} = (2, \; 1)A=(6,4)andB=(2,1)

Subtracting: A−B=(6−2,  4−1)=(4,  3)\mathbf{A} – \mathbf{B} = (6-2, \; 4-1) = (4, \; 3)A−B=(6−2,4−1)=(4,3)

Magnitude: ∣A−B∣=42+32=16+9=5|\mathbf{A} – \mathbf{B}| = \sqrt{4^2 + 3^2} = \sqrt{16 + 9} = 5∣A−B∣=42+32​=16+9​=5

Direction (angle from x-axis): θ=arctan⁡(34)≈36.87∘\theta = \arctan\left(\frac{3}{4}\right) \approx 36.87^\circθ=arctan(43​)≈36.87∘

So, the resultant vector is (4, 3) with a magnitude of 5 and a direction of about 36.9°.

💡 Tips for Vector Subtraction

  • Always align vectors component-wise before subtracting.
  • Double-check signs (+/-) when entering values.
  • Remember: vector subtraction is not commutative (A−B≠B−AA – B \neq B – AA−B=B−A).
  • If working in 3D, include the z-components to avoid errors.
